Ivy Classical Academy pushes back first day of school; Meet the Teacher event is Aug. 3

From Ivy

Classical Academy

Dear Parents of Ivy Classical Academy Students,

The Ivy Classical Academy governing board and leadership team have chosen to move the first day of school for Ivy Classical Academy students to August 21.

All facility renovations are moving forward on schedule. Unfortunately, we recently received news that there has been a delay in the delivery of our air conditioning units. As a result, we have decided to move back our planned start date by two weeks.

We expect most founding families will enjoy having two additional weeks of summer break before the beginning of the school year. However, if your family is in need of childcare from August 7 through August 20 and unable to attain it elsewhere, please contact our front office at 334-595-5580, ext. 1. We can help you arrange childcare during that time.

With the rescheduling of the first day of school, we will also be rescheduling our planned PSO meeting and open houses.

We will be hosting a “Meet the Teacher” and “Playdate” event at 17 Springs on August 3rd. See below for the times by grade level for your child to meet their teacher and classmates. Please RSVP at https://secure.qgiv.com/for/parentorientation/event/august-5th/

We will also be hosting a “Parent Information and Orientation Evening” at Centerpoint Fellowship Church on Monday, August 5 at 6pm. Please RSVP here if you plan to attend. The event will be filmed and shared on Ivy Classical Academy’s social media for those unable to attend.
